AI編程工具拖后腿?資深開發(fā)者效率反降

極客網·人工智能7月11日 近年來,AI編程助手如GitHub Copilot、Cursor等工具的興起,被視為軟件開發(fā)領域的革命性突破。許多企業(yè)和技術專家認為,這些工具能夠顯著提升開發(fā)效率,甚至可能改變程序員的工作方式。

然而,非營利機構METR的最新研究卻提出了一個令人意外的結論:對于經驗豐富的開發(fā)者而言,AI工具在熟悉的代碼庫中反而可能降低效率。這一發(fā)現挑戰(zhàn)了業(yè)界對AI編程助手的普遍預期,也引發(fā)了關于AI在實際開發(fā)場景中適用性的深入討論。

研究揭示效率悖論

METR的研究聚焦于資深開發(fā)者在熟悉的開源項目中使用AI編程助手Cursor的表現。研究開始前,參與者普遍預計AI能夠幫助他們節(jié)省約24%的時間。然而,實際數據顯示,使用AI后,任務完成時間反而增加了19%。這一結果與研究者的初始預期形成鮮明對比——研究負責人之一內特·拉什甚至曾預測AI可能讓開發(fā)速度翻倍。

研究指出,效率下降的主要原因是開發(fā)者需要花費額外時間檢查和修正AI生成的代碼建議。雖然AI的建議在方向上通常是正確的,但在細節(jié)上往往不符合實際需求。資深開發(fā)者對代碼庫的結構和邏輯有深刻理解,因此AI生成的代碼片段可能無法完全匹配他們的高標準要求,反而增加了調試和調整的工作量。

與過往研究的矛盾

這一發(fā)現與過去關于AI編程助手的研究形成了鮮明對比。例如,此前有研究表明,AI工具能夠幫助程序員將開發(fā)速度提升56%,或在固定時間內完成更多任務。然而,METR的研究強調,這些積極結果可能并不適用于所有場景。尤其是在大型成熟的開源代碼庫中,資深開發(fā)者對代碼的熟悉程度較高,AI的介入反而可能成為干擾因素。

研究作者指出,許多早期研究依賴于基準測試或簡單任務,而這些測試可能無法真實反映復雜開發(fā)環(huán)境中的實際需求。在現實工作中,開發(fā)者需要處理更復雜的邏輯、更嚴格的性能要求以及更緊密的團隊協(xié)作,AI工具的局限性可能因此被放大。

初級開發(fā)者與資深開發(fā)者的差異

值得注意的是,研究也表明,這種效率下降的現象可能不會出現在初級開發(fā)者或對代碼庫不熟悉的工程師身上。對于新手程序員來說,AI工具能夠提供即時建議,減少學習曲線,甚至幫助他們快速掌握最佳實踐。相比之下,資深開發(fā)者更傾向于依賴自己的經驗和知識體系,AI的建議可能被視為額外的負擔,而非真正的助力。

開發(fā)者的真實體驗

盡管AI工具在某些情況下降低了效率,但大多數參與研究的開發(fā)者仍然選擇繼續(xù)使用Cursor。他們表示,AI讓開發(fā)過程變得更加輕松愉快,就像“修改一篇文章”而非“從空白開始寫作”。研究負責人喬爾·貝克指出,開發(fā)者的目標不僅僅是“更快完成任務”,而是選擇一種“付出更少努力”的路徑。這表明,AI的價值可能不僅體現在效率上,還體現在減輕認知負擔和提升工作體驗方面。

對行業(yè)的影響

這一研究對AI編程工具的推廣和投資方向提出了重要問題。目前,許多企業(yè)將AI視為提升高薪工程師效率的關鍵,甚至有人認為AI可能替代初級程序員崗位。然而,METR的研究表明,AI的實際效果可能因開發(fā)者經驗和項目復雜度而異。企業(yè)在引入AI工具時,需要更謹慎地評估其適用場景,避免盲目依賴技術解決方案。

未來展望

盡管當前研究揭示了AI工具的局限性,但這并不意味著AI在編程領域的潛力被否定。相反,這一發(fā)現呼吁更精細化的工具設計,例如針對不同經驗水平的開發(fā)者提供差異化支持,或優(yōu)化AI對復雜代碼庫的理解能力。未來的AI編程助手可能需要更加注重與人類開發(fā)者的協(xié)作,而非單純追求代碼生成速度。

結論

METR的研究為AI編程工具的討論增添了新的維度。它提醒我們,技術工具的價值并非絕對,而是取決于具體的使用場景和用戶群體。對于資深開發(fā)者而言,AI可能是一把雙刃劍——既能提供靈感,也可能帶來額外的調整成本。這一發(fā)現促使行業(yè)更加理性地看待AI的作用,同時也為工具優(yōu)化指明了方向。在AI與人類協(xié)作的道路上,平衡效率與體驗,或許是未來的關鍵課題。

(免責聲明:本網站內容主要來自原創(chuàng)、合作伙伴供稿和第三方自媒體作者投稿,凡在本網站出現的信息,均僅供參考。本網站將盡力確保所提供信息的準確性及可靠性,但不保證有關資料的準確性及可靠性,讀者在使用前請進一步核實,并對任何自主決定的行為負責。本網站對有關資料所引致的錯誤、不確或遺漏,概不負任何法律責任。
任何單位或個人認為本網站中的網頁或鏈接內容可能涉嫌侵犯其知識產權或存在不實內容時,應及時向本網站提出書面權利通知或不實情況說明,并提供身份證明、權屬證明及詳細侵權或不實情況證明。本網站在收到上述法律文件后,將會依法盡快聯系相關文章源頭核實,溝通刪除相關內容或斷開相關鏈接。 )

贊助商
2025-07-11
AI編程工具拖后腿?資深開發(fā)者效率反降
AI編程工具拖后腿?資深開發(fā)者效率反降 近年來,AI編程助手如GitHub Copilot、Cursor等工具的興起,被視為軟件開發(fā)領域的革命性突破...

長按掃碼 閱讀全文